Are french fries OK for diabetics?

French fries are a food you may want to steer clear of, especially if you have diabetes. Potatoes themselves are relatively high in carbs. One medium potato contains 34.8 grams of carbs, 2.4 of which come from fiber ( 53 ).

How much fries can a diabetic eat?

Our general rule of thumb is to consume about 15-20 grams of carbohydrates per meal with a max of 30 grams, so that puts these french fries, even the small ones, way out of range.

Do french fries affect blood sugar?

A glycemic index of 55 and under is low, a GI of 56 to 69 is medium and a GI of 70 or over is high. French fries have a GI of 75, making them high on the glycemic index and likely to cause spikes in blood glucose even if you only eat one serving.

Does fried potatoes raise blood sugar?

They're also chock full of starch, which is a carbohydrate. But even though a potato is considered a complex “healthy” carb, your body digests these carbs faster than other kinds of complex carbs. These broken-down carbs flood your blood with sugar. This makes your blood sugar spike quickly.

Can diabetics eat fried potatoes?

Deep- or shallow-frying potatoes in certain oils and fats, such as animal fats, can increase their saturated and trans fat content. This might increase the risk of heart disease , especially in people with diabetes who already have an increased risk of cardiovascular disease.
